New Direct Selling Growth & Outlook Results Show Growth in Annual Retail Sales, Number of Sellers, and Consumer Demand

U.S. Direct Selling Annual Retail Sales Reach $35.4 Billion

WASHINGTON--()--The Direct Selling Association (DSA) released its 2019 Direct Selling Growth and Outlook Survey results today, showing a solid growth in retail sales, as well as the number of people selling and purchasing products and service through the direct sales channel. Growth & Outlook is DSA’s annual survey that reports on the size and scope of direct selling in the U.S. and is audited by Nathan Associates, a third-party international economic consulting firm.

The annual Direct Selling Growth & Outlook Survey provided the following data on the industry:

  • Retail Sales are Up: The direct selling channel generated $35.4 billion in retail sales in 2018 – this is up 1.3 percent from 2017.
  • The Number of Direct Sellers is Up: The number of people selling products or services using the direct selling model grew 1.6 percent, with more than 6 million U.S. entrepreneurs selling in either a part-time of full-time basis.
  • Demand for Direct Selling Products is Up: In 2018, there were more than 36.6 million people actively buying through the direct sales channel, with notable growth coming from an increase in preferred customers. This customer count excludes those who have not signed an agreement with a direct selling company.

ABOUT THE DIRECT SELLING ASSOCIATION

The Direct Selling Association (DSA) is the national trade association for companies that offer entrepreneurial opportunities to independent sellers to market and sell products and services, typically outside of a fixed retail establishment. In 2018, direct selling took place in every state, generating $35.4 billion in retail sales. More than six million entrepreneurs in the U.S. are selling products or services through the direct selling channel, providing a personalized buying experience for many million customers.
